Output d1d31c90c0eaab339f3f9d4d2a744059a1a60f729c5616a5c712015b5020d93e:7

value
319044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b7f0cec1f8ce9335b3b2832f524bf5a27bfe3c2 OP_EQUAL
address
3PACvFDMiPFP3i92ZyedazSkdyRWPcXuCw
transaction
d1d31c90c0eaab339f3f9d4d2a744059a1a60f729c5616a5c712015b5020d93e
confirmations
300543
spent
true